Nine of the Divas who performed throughout the past year are scheduled to appear, including Jessica Lee, Lisa Ferraro, Kenia, Shari Richards, Donna Bailey, Antoinette, Lilly Abreu, Lisa Bleil and Maureen Budway. Diva Tuesdays at Blue, started one February night a year ago by Blue owner Jay Fairbrother, has featured a series of solo vocalists in a broad range of musical styles and genres, from blues to jazz, pop and soul. To celebrate a successful year in which Blue has drawn capacity crowds at the restaurant's bar and casual dining area, Fairbrother has invited some of the top performing artists to appear for one night on stage, with each vocalist slated to perform two or three songs, with perhaps an occasional duet. The Divas will be accompanied by pianist Scott Anderson. "We're expecting some great music on our little stage, and some surprises in the evening's line up, too," said Fairbrother. "This is as much a tribute to the incredible vocal talent we have in the area, as it is an anniversary celebration. We wanted to give something special back to our loyal customers and the fans of these wonderful performers." Oliverio, SPHR | EDMC Online Higher Education Vice President - Human Resources 1400 Penn Avenue Pittsburgh, PA 15222-4332 Toll Free: 866-421-4OHE Phone: 412-995-2788 Mobile: 412-651-5654 Fax: 412-291-2983 joliverio@edmc.edu www.edmc.edu ****************************************************************************** ===================================================================== La Unión Cultural Latinoamericana (LACU) es una organización voluntaria, sin fines de lucro y que cuenta con el status 501(c)(3), donaciones son deducibles de impuestos. La misión es promover y preservar las diversas manifestaciones culturales latinoamericanas en la región de Pittsburgh a través de actividades de sus socios, del newsletter, tri-mensual, bilingüe, “Noticiero”, el programa para niños “Sábado Latino Infantil”, conversación inglés-castellano, acceso a grupos musicales latinos, bailes típicos, la GALA Latina, y eventos culturales. ================================================================= LACU NUEVAS es un boletín electrónico semanal que llega a los miembros de LACU para mantenerlos informados de las actividades latinoamericanas en la región de Pittsburgh.Weekly, email bulletin whose goal is to keep you current of the Latin American programs and events in the Pittsburgh region. Box 19403, Pittsburgh, PA 15213 MEMO: Indicate: LACU NUEVAS Advertisement. ===================================================================== NOTICIERO is the trimester, bilingual newsletter that circulates quarterly (Jan-Mar, Apr-Jun, Jul-Sep, Oct-Dec) and publishes articles and news about the Latin American community as well as other topics of interest in the region, the nation and abroad. The goal of NOTICIERO is to inform not only the Latino audience but also the community in general regarding diverse topics. NOTICIERO has print and on-line editions. The audience of NOTICIERO includes around 1000 readers among LACU members and friends who visit the on-line version through www.lacunet.org , and people reading the print issues circulating in Mexican and Latino restaurants, colleges/universities, libraries and the distribution lists of our partner organizations (5000 readers approximately).
